The American Welding Society (AWS) is a non-profit organization that was founded in 1919. AWS is a worldwide leader in the advancement of welding and allied processes, serving over 70,000 members from more than 100 countries worldwide. This organization provides a forum for the exchange of information and technology among its members, including engineers, researchers, welding experts, educators, students, and welding industry professionals. AWS offers various certification programs and educational opportunities, including seminars, conferences, and online courses. AWS also publishes a variety of materials, such as books, magazines, and technical literature to advance the welding industry. The society also provides networking and volunteer opportunities for its members through its local chapters and technical committees. Additionally, AWS holds a variety of standards for welding safety and procedures, including the popular AWS D1.1 Structural Welding Code. The organization works closely with government agencies and other organizations to promote and improve welding education, standards, and practices. The American Welding Society is dedicated to advancing the science, technology, and application of welding and allied processes to benefit humanity.
